KOCH WINE FRAUD CASE TURNS PERSONAL
Apr 3, 2013
(TheDrinksBusiness) - The wine fraud case being played out in a New York court room between rival billionaires turned personal this week as a former servant of Eric Greenberg took the stand against his one-time employer.
Jaime Cortes worked for Eric Greenberg for four years as his personal chef and manager of his home in Ross, California. According to Forbes, he took the stand as a witness against his former employer after reading about the case in The Wine Spectator and offering his services to Bill Koch’s legal team – the billionaire wine collector is suing Greenberg for US$320,000.
Although there is some doubt as to whether or not this breaches a confidentiality agreement he signed is in question – he claims he does not remember signing it. Koch is not recompensing him for being a witness but is said to be covering his legal fees.
